Washer Tank and Washer Pump Removal and
Installation
S7RS0B9406002
Removal1) Disconnect negative (–) cable at battery.
2) Remove front bumper referring to “Front Bumper and Rear Bumper Components in Section 9K”.
3) Remove grommet (1) and upper part (2) of washer tank.
4) Remove washer tank attaching bolts (4).
5) Disconnect washer pump lead wire couplers and hoses.
6) Remove washer tank (1).
7) Remove windshield washer pump (2) and rear washer pump (3) from washer tank (1). Installation
Install washer tank and washer pump by reversing
removal procedure, noting the following instructions.
• Connect washer pump connector(s) securely.
• Tighten washer tank bolts to specified torque.
Tightening torque
Washer tank bolt (a): 4 N·m (0.4 kgf-m, 3.0 lb-ft)
Washer Pump InspectionS7RS0B9406003
1) Connect battery positive (+) and negative (–) terminals to pump (+) and (–) terminals respectively.
2) Check windshield and rear washer pumps for
operation.
If pump does not operate, replace washer pump.

Windshield Wiper Removal and InstallationS7RS0B9406004
Removal1) Disconnect negative (–) cable at battery.
2) Remove wiper pivot caps (1) and wiper arm nuts (2), and remove windshield wiper arms with wiper blades
(3).
3) Remove cowl top garnish referring to “Cowl Top Components in Section 9K”.
4) Disconnect coupler from windshield wiper motor.
5) Remove bolts (1), and remove windshield wiper assembly (2). Installation
1) Install windshield wiper assembly (1), and tighten bolts to specified torque.
Tightening torque
Windshield wiper bolt (a): 8 N·m (0.8 kgf-m, 6.0
lb-ft)
2) Connect coupler to windshield wiper motor.
3) Install cowl top garnish referring to “Cowl Top
Components in Section 9K”.
4) Install windshield wiper arms with wiper blades (1) to specified position as shown in figure, and then
tighten windshield wiper nuts to specified torque.
Tightening torque
Windshield wiper arm nut (a): 16 N·m (1.6 kgf-
m, 11.5 lb-ft)
5) Install wiper pivot caps (2 ) to windshield wiper arm
nuts.
6) Connect negative (–) cable to battery.

Windshield Wiper Motor InspectionS7RS0B9406005
NOTE
Make sure that battery voltage is 12 V or
more.
1) Disconnect negative (–) cable at battery.
2) Remove windshield wiper arms with wiper blades
referring to “Windshield Wiper Removal and
Installation”.
3) Remove cowl top garnish referring to “Cowl Top Components in Section 9K”.
4) Disconnect coupler from windshield wiper motor.
5) Reinstall windshield wiper arms with wiper blade. For
details, refer to Step 4) of “Installation” in “Windshield
Wiper Removal and Installation”.
6) Check windshield wiper motor for operation as
follows
• For motor operation in low speed
a. Connect battery positive (+) terminal to terminal “1” and its negative (–) terminal to
terminal “5”.
b. Check if wiper arm reciprocation speed is as specification. If check result is not as
specified, replace motor.
Specification
LH steering vehicle: 42 – 50 r/min (rpm)
RH steering vehicle: 41 – 51 r/min (rpm) • For motor operation in high speed
a. Connect battery positive (+) terminal to “2” and its negative (–) terminal to terminal “5”.
b. Check if motor revolution speed is as specification. If chec k result is not as
specified, replace motor.
Specification
LH steering vehicle: 66 – 76 r/min (rpm)
RH steering vehicle: 60 – 76 r/min (rpm)
• For automatic stop operation a. Connect battery positive (+) terminal to terminal “1” and its negative (–) terminal to
terminal “5” and let the motor turn.
b. Disconnect terminal “1” from battery positive (+) terminal, and let the motor stop.
c. Connect terminals “1” and “3” with a jumper wire, and connect terminal “4” to battery
positive (+) terminal.
Observe the motor turns once again then
stops at a specified position as shown.
d. Repeat Step a to c several times and check that the motor stops at the specified position
every time.
If check result is not satisfied, replace motor.

Rear Wiper Removal and InstallationS7RS0B9406006
Removal1) Disconnect negative (–) cable at battery.
2) Remove arm cover (1), rear wiper arm nut (2), rear wiper arm with blade assembly (3), rear wiper pivot
cap (4), rear wiper nut (5) and rear wiper seal (6).
3) Remove rear end door trim referring to “Rear End Door Lock Assembly Remo val and Installation in
Section 9F”.
4) Disconnect coupler from rear wiper motor.
5) Remove rear wiper motor.
Installation 1) Install rear wiper motor (1) and tighten rear wiper motor mounting bolts to specified torque.
Tightening torque
Rear wiper motor mounting bolt (a): 8 N·m (0.8
kgf-m, 6.0 lb-ft) 2) Connect coupler to rear wiper motor
3) Install rear end door trim referring to “Rear End Door
Lock Assembly Removal and Installation in Section
9F”.
4) Install rear wiper seal (1), and tighten rear wiper nut to specified torque.
Tightening torque
Rear wiper nut (a): 5 N·m (0.5 kgf-m, 4.0 lb-ft)
5) Install rear wiper pivot cap (2).
6) Install rear wiper arm with blade assembly (1) to specified position as shown in figure.
7) Tighten rear wiper arm nut to specified torque, and then install arm cover (1).
Tightening torque
Rear wiper arm nut (a): 8 N·m (0.8 kgf-m, 6.0 lb-
ft)
8) Connect negative (–) cable to battery.

Rear Wiper Motor InspectionS7RS0B9406007
NOTE
Make sure that battery voltage is 12 V or
more.
1) Make a mark (1) on rear wiper motor (2) stop position as shown.
2) Check rear wiper motor for operation as follows. • For motor operationa. Connect battery positive terminal to terminal “1” and its negative terminal to terminal “2”.
b. Check motor revolution speed as specification. If check result is not as
specified, replace motor.
Specification
35 – 45 r/min (rpm) • For automatic stop operation
a. Connect battery positive (+) terminal to terminal “1” and its negative (–) terminal to
terminal “2” and let the motor turn.
b. Disconnect terminal “2” from battery negative (–) terminal and let the motor stop.
c. Observe the motor (4) turns once again then stops at a specified position as shown.
d. Repeat Step a. to c. several times and check that the motor stops at the specified position
every time.
If check result is not satisfied, replace motor.

Windshield Wiper and Washer Switch
Inspection
S7RS0B9406009
Windshield Wiper and Washer Switch
Check for continuity between terminals at each switch
position. If check result is not as specified, replace
switch. Intermittent Wiper Relay Circuit
1) Turn the windshield wiper switch to “INT” position.
2) Connect battery positive (+ ) terminal to terminal “5”
and its negative (–) terminal to terminal “2”.
3) Connect voltmeter positive lead to terminal “4” and its negative lead to terminal “2”.
4) Check that the voltmeter indicates the battery voltage (10 – 14 V).
5) Connect terminal “3” and terminal “5” by a jumper wire.
6) Disconnect end of the jumper wire from terminal “5”.
7) Connect disconnected jumper wire end to terminal “2”, then check that voltage between terminal “4” and
terminal “2” changes as shown.
If check result is not satisfied, replace switch.
